多台服务器如何双机热备
-
要实现多台服务器的双机热备,需要采取一定的策略和技术来确保数据的高可用性和系统的连续性。下面是一种常见的方案:
-
配置主备服务器:首先,选择两台性能相当的服务器作为主备服务器。其中一台作为主服务器,负责处理用户的请求和数据处理;另一台作为备服务器,处于待命状态,随时准备接管主服务器的工作。
-
设置双机热备模式:通过网络连接将主备服务器连接起来,建立高速通信通道。确保主备服务器之间可以实时同步数据,并能够及时传递状态信息。可以使用专用的双机热备软件来管理主备服务器的运行状态。
-
数据同步和镜像:主备服务器之间需要进行数据同步和镜像,以确保备服务器上的数据与主服务器保持一致。可以使用数据库复制、文件同步或者分布式文件系统等技术来实现数据的实时同步。
-
心跳和监控机制:通过心跳检测机制,实时监测主服务器的运行状态。当主服务器出现故障或不可用时,备服务器可以迅速接管并继续提供服务。可以使用专门的心跳软件或自行开发程序来实现心跳检测和状态切换。
-
故障切换和恢复:在主服务器故障时,备服务器会自动接管服务,并立即向相关的网络设备和路由器发送通知,确保流量被正确地路由到备服务器。一旦主服务器恢复正常,系统会自动切换回主服务器,并重新同步数据。
-
容灾测试和监测:定期进行容灾测试,模拟主服务器故障的场景,并确保备服务器能够正常接管服务。同时,配置监测系统,实时监测主备服务器的运行状态和性能,及时发现并解决潜在问题。
总之,多台服务器的双机热备方案可以保证系统的高可用性和连续性,提供稳定可靠的服务。根据实际需求和资源情况,可以选择合适的技术和工具来实施双机热备,并定期进行测试和监测,以确保系统在故障情况下能够快速恢复并保持正常运行。
1年前 -
-
多台服务器的双机热备是一种常用的高可用性解决方案,可以确保在一台服务器发生故障或停机的情况下,另一台服务器能够立即接管工作,确保系统的连续运行。以下是实现多台服务器双机热备的几种常见方法。
-
心跳监测
多台服务器之间通过网络建立心跳通道,相互监测状态。如果一台服务器在设定的时间内没有收到另一台服务器的心跳信号,就意味着后者出现故障,可以立即进行切换。这种方式的好处是实时性高,能够在几秒内完成切换。 -
共享存储
多台服务器可以共享相同的存储设备,包括硬盘、磁盘阵列等。在这种情况下,只需要将故障服务器上的数据镜像到备用服务器上,当主服务器故障时,可以立即将备用服务器设置为主服务器,继续提供服务。这种方式的好处是数据同步简单,切换速度快,但需要考虑共享存储的性能和可靠性。 -
负载均衡
通过负载均衡技术,将多台服务器组成一个逻辑的集群,分担网络流量和请求。当其中一台服务器故障时,负载均衡器会将流量自动转发到其他正常工作的服务器上,保证服务的连续性。这种方式的好处是具有较好的性能和扩展性,但需要考虑负载均衡器的单点故障问题。 -
双机热备软件
通过使用专门的双机热备软件(如Veritas Cluster)来实现多台服务器的双机热备。该软件可以监控服务器的运行状态,并在检测到故障时进行自动切换。这种方式的好处是实现方便,可配置性高,但需要额外的软件和配置。 -
虚拟化技术
利用虚拟化技术可以实现在物理服务器之间实现双机热备。通过将多个物理服务器上的虚拟机镜像进行复制和同步,当主服务器故障时,备用服务器上的虚拟机可以立即启动,继续提供服务。这种方式的好处是灵活性高,可以根据需求进行扩展和收缩,但需要考虑虚拟化平台的性能和可靠性。
总之,多台服务器的双机热备能够提高系统的可用性和容错能力,确保系统在故障发生时能够快速恢复并继续提供服务。选择合适的双机热备方案需要根据具体的系统需求和预算来决定。
1年前 -
-
双机热备是一种通过在多台服务器之间共享负载的方式实现高可用性的方法。在双机热备环境中,当主服务器发生故障时,备用服务器会自动接管主服务器的工作,以确保系统的连续运行。下面是多台服务器如何实现双机热备的一般操作流程:
-
确定双机热备方案:首先,需要确定双机热备的具体方案和需求。例如,是通过硬件设备(如负载均衡器)实现双机热备,还是通过软件(如操作系统层面的集群管理软件)实现双机热备等。
-
配置网络环境:将所有服务器连接到同一个局域网中,并确保服务器之间可以相互通信。
-
安装和配置操作系统:在每台服务器上安装相同的操作系统,并进行基本的网络和系统设置。
-
安装和配置双机热备软件:根据方案选择,安装并配置双机热备软件。这些软件的作用是监测主服务器的状态,并在主服务器故障时自动将备用服务器切换为主服务器。
-
配置共享存储:为了使主服务器和备用服务器能够共享数据,需要配置共享存储。可以使用网络存储设备(如SAN、NAS)或者共享文件系统(如NFS、CIFS)来实现。
-
设置双机热备策略:根据实际需求,设置双机热备的策略,包括主备服务器切换的触发条件、切换时间等。
-
进行测试和验证:在正式上线之前,进行测试和验证双机热备方案的可靠性和稳定性。
-
监测和维护:一旦双机热备系统正式上线,需要通过监测主服务器和备用服务器的状态来确保系统的可用性。同时,定期进行系统的维护和升级。
总结:
多台服务器的双机热备是一种实现高可用性的方式,通过配置网络环境、安装和配置操作系统、安装和配置双机热备软件、配置共享存储、设置双机热备策略、进行测试和验证以及监测和维护等步骤来实现。这样一来,当主服务器发生故障时,备用服务器可以自动接管并保证系统的连续运行。1年前 -